WebApr 9, 2024 · Total annual expenditures: $61,908. The overall cost of living in Texas is 7.5% lower than the national average, which puts the state in America’s top 15 cheapest. Housing leads the way at 15.3% lower. Groceries, meanwhile, cost 9.7% less, and miscellaneous costs are 3.1% lower. New Hampshire residents pay no state income tax, state or local sales tax, and don’t pay estate or inheritance taxes. The state gasoline tax is set at a moderate 24 cents per gallon.
